Add 54/4 and 4/63

1st number: 13 2/4, 2nd number: 4/63

54/4 + 4/63 is 1709/126.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 4 and 63 is 252

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 252
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 4 × 63 = 252,
    54/4 = 54 × 63/4 × 63 = 3402/252
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 63 × 4 = 252,
    4/63 = 4 × 4/63 × 4 = 16/252
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    3402/252 + 16/252 = 3402 + 16/252 = 3418/252
  5. 3418/252 simplified gives 1709/126
  6. So, 54/4 + 4/63 = 1709/126
